Kai M. Thaler is a scholar working on Sociology and Political Science, Political Science and International Relations and Health. According to data from OpenAlex, Kai M. Thaler has authored 22 papers receiving a total of 157 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 18 papers in Sociology and Political Science, 7 papers in Political Science and International Relations and 4 papers in Health. Recurrent topics in Kai M. Thaler’s work include Political Conflict and Governance (9 papers), Peacebuilding and International Security (4 papers) and Intimate Partner and Family Violence (4 papers). Kai M. Thaler is often cited by papers focused on Political Conflict and Governance (9 papers), Peacebuilding and International Security (4 papers) and Intimate Partner and Family Violence (4 papers). Kai M. Thaler collaborates with scholars based in United States, South Africa and United Kingdom. Kai M. Thaler's co-authors include Jeremy Seekings, Jason Warner, Jonathan Leader Maynard and Max Abrahms and has published in prestigious journals such as World Development, The Journal of Politics and Political Science Quarterly.
